Not known Details About Limo Nottingham

Nottingham is really a premier location for consumers and with in excess of 1300 stores selling a large variety of items - it isn't really challenging to see why. Town centre boasts A few recognisable department shops and two browsing centres to attract visitors from all regions of the united kingdom. Undercover locations like the Broadmarsh and Vi

read more